Tolland market and investor summary

In Tolland, NSW 2650, the median house sells for around $625K, on a gross rental yield of 4.2% for houses. House prices have moved +19.9% over the past year. At 2.4% vacancy, it is a broadly balanced rental market.

For an investor, the rent-to-price profile sits mid-range: a gross house yield near 4.2% is neither a standout cashflow play nor a pure growth bet.

Living in Tolland: people, income and schools

Tolland is home to around 3,459 people, a number that has held fairly steady over five years. At a median age of 34, it reads as broadly working-age, and families account for 67% of households.

The typical household income runs to around $63,000 a year (about $1,210 a week). On socio-economic measures it ranks around the national middle on the ABS advantage index (5 out of 10). At current prices a median house runs to a steep 10.0 times local household income, so affordability is a genuine constraint on local buyers. Incomes have risen about 15% over five years, which tends to underpin what local buyers can pay.

Families have 31 schools within roughly 5km to choose from, testing below the national school average on ICSEA. It is fairly car-dependent; the suburb scores 40 for walkability and 5 for transit out of 100. Fixed broadband is delivered over the NBN's Fibre to the Node.

Frequently asked questions about Tolland

What should I check before investing in Tolland?

Tolland has enough public data for first-pass screening across yield, vacancy, price and supply signals. House gross rental yield of 4.2% gives a usable rent-to-price starting point. Capital growth of +19.9% in the past year shows strong recent price momentum. Compare those signals with nearby suburbs and individual listings before relying on the suburb-level view.

What are typical property prices in Tolland?

The median property price in Tolland, NSW 2650 is $625K for houses.

What rental yield does Tolland show?

The gross rental yield in Tolland is 4.2% for houses. Gross yield is calculated as annual rent divided by property price, and it doesn't account for expenses or tax.

What does recent house price growth show for Tolland?

House prices in Tolland are up 19.9% over the past year. Capital growth is a key driver of total investment return, so pair it with rental yield to get a full picture.

How tight is the rental market in Tolland?

The current vacancy rate in Tolland is 2.4%. A rate under 2% generally signals a tight rental market. This suburb's rental market is balanced, favouring neither landlords nor tenants strongly.

How many people live in Tolland?

Tolland has a population of approximately 3,459 residents, with a median age of 34.

What schools are near Tolland?

There are 31 schools within roughly 5km of Tolland. Their average ICSEA is below the national mean of 1000. ICSEA is the ABS measure of a school community's socio-educational advantage.

Is Tolland affordable to buy in?

A median house in Tolland costs about 10.0 times the median local household income (a high multiple that makes the suburb a stretch for median local earners). The ratio compares the median house price with annual household income; it is a rough affordability gauge, not a substitute for your own borrowing assessment.

Is Tolland's population growing?

The population of Tolland has grown modestly, about 2% over five years. Population growth feeds underlying housing demand, so it is worth weighing alongside price and yield.
